Im looking a getting a dog and want to know everthing before making any decisions.

I grew up with dogs and have had plenty of friends with dogs....but never a crate in sight?? Ive been lurking in the dog house section and notice alot of you use crate training?

so was just wondering what its about and if having a crate is a must or down to choice? how does it help you?

plus looking at list of things i will need (such as crate) to get a rough idea of cost.

I've also grown up with dogs and decided that my parents had never used one and we got on ok and therefore crates were cruel, unnecessary etc. - needless to say, now I've got a puppy of my own I think they are the work of a genius!

We use ours to confine Daisy when we're busy and can't watch her (it seems most damage is caused by dogs/puppies when they're unsupervised) so for eg. when I need take my daughters upstairs to get dressed for school, I pop Daisy in her crate with her kong. Ditto bedtime for my girls and obviously when I go out. She also sleeps in her crate at night. I have tried to get her to nap in it during the day but she likes to sleep wherever I am, so if I'm in the kitchen she'll lay in the there, same for sitting room, garden etc.

I can only imagine if I left Daisy loose in the house when I couldn't supervise her, that she would be causing mayhem in no time!
